I've pissed off a lot of gay rights activists and gay friends by saying the marriage thing is not the big thing to me. Being able to share the same rights as married couples is. A certificate from some outside source isn't going to change how I feel about her, but I would like to know I can go to her hospital room, have a say in what happens to her, and have legal rights with regards to our kids. When we flew overseas with them earlier this year, we had to have their father write and sign a waiver and they still did not understand why I wanted to sit next to my kids. Who knows what would have happened if something happened to E or the boys anywhere along the trip? When that can be sorted out, then I'll celebrate.
